FOR SALE… 2004 Jeanneau Sun Odyssey 54DS
Physical Location USVI
Titled and registered in Florida
Loa 54’ 11”
Beam 15’ 8”
Draft 6’ 5”
Air draft 72’
Layout: One Extra large Forward cabin, two large aft cabins, Plus an additional crew quarter area in the Bow
Everybody loves a little character… Jeanneau? ?
In 2019 this vessel earned her “survivor badge” when she experienced some damage through a storm(NOT Irma), there was no major structural damage done at that time but there was a hull to deck seem split on the port side which resulted in some heavy weathering before we came along to give her the love she deserved… The damage has been repaired professionally With six layers of biaxle and epoxy. Every sheet of biaxle being 4 inches larger in all directions then the previous sheet… although there were storm damages they were relatively minor in the big scheme of things and this boat does have a CLEAN title! NOT a salvage title… she has been actively sailing and cruising over 5000nm since then…. she just completed a 510 nautical mile passage just two weeks ago NOV 10-14th… The cosmetics on the damage area have yet to be finalized. all photos were taken recently most within the last week some within the last few months.
She is the “fully loaded” package from the factory with all power winches electric heads, teak decks, etc. With a little Bright work, some cabin cushions, and Galley cabinetry she could easily become an appreciating asset for you with her true market value being around 300K…. But she is comfortably livable and ready to go cruising AS IS with fully functional Sail and power…. She has also been owned and operated by Marine engineers for the past three years with the focus and accomplishment of becoming a completely off the grid self sustained vessel.
Equipment
*110 hp Volvo diesel
* Barrier coat in 2023 (it’s important to note that Jeanneau for some ridiculous reason does not barrier coat their boats from the factory so if you’re familiar with the protection of barrier coat and the work it takes to strip down to apply this…this is huge!)
*New Trinidad pro bottom paint 2023
*newly fabricated hi grade 316L stainless steel brackets in 2023 (important to note that any sistership will come with the low-grade rust bucket factory brakets, which is a huge safety issue but not here with this upgrade)
*all halyards and sheets replaced with new or gently used in 2020
*converted to a 24 v boat with LIFEPO4 Lithium in 2021
*converted to 110 ac power instead of European 220 in 2021
*1690 watts of solar 2022
*simrad chart plotter
*raymarine autohelm(works excellent)
*projector with projector screen
*victron battery monitoring system bmv712
*victron multiplus inverter/charger 2000w/24v/110v
*victron cerbo gx with touch display 2023
*24v spectra 400 water maker with new membrane 2023 (17 gph)
*24 V in counter LARGE refrigerator and freezer … please note the deep freezer is NOT the freezer noted. It could be kept or disposed of. It does function perfectly and the boat runs it with ease. But there is table leg to replace it if you choose to remove it.
*NEW Dickinson Mediterranean 3 burner stove and oven propane
*comfee washing machine
*new 24v SS water heater
* complete windless overhaul in 2023
*new 105 lb Mantus 2020
*300 feet of new G4 chain 2023*spare delta anchor and rhode
*spare fortress anchor and rhode
